The corporate credit rating on Beverly Hills, Calif.-based Live Nation Entertainment Inc. reflects Standard & Poor’s Ratings Services’ expectation that leverage will remain relatively high, but that operating performance will continue to be somewhat stable, because of to the company’s degree of business diversity. Live Nation Entertainment Inc.'s Ba3 rating benefits from sustainable and predictable cash flow, solid liquidity, good scale and competitive positioning, and expectations that debt/EBITDA leverage will be normalize below 4x by 2020 after acquisitions are executed during 2018/19 (Moody's adjusted; 4.2x at 31Dec17; 4.7x pro forma for pending debt issuance).
